Capacity note for the Bramblewick export retry queue. Failed exports are requeued with exponential backoff, and the queue depth is our main capacity signal: sustained depth above the high-water mark means downstream Pellis storage is saturated, not that we need more workers. As the new contractor, please don't raise worker counts without checking storage latency first — it usually makes things worse. Retry timing, backoff caps, and the high-water threshold are all driven by the constants shown below.

limits module of yagef-bajog:
TIERS = {
    "druael": 370,
    "tamix": 286,
    "pelius": 541,
    "pelael": 78,
    "pelox": 47,
    "ralath": 533,
    "drumir": 801,
}

## Changelog — Tidemark Widget 3.2

Defaults changed. Read before touching anything.

- Refresh interval now hourly, not every 15 min. Harbor feeds from the Pellisport aggregator throttle aggressive polling.
- Lunar-offset correction is on by default. Disable only for legacy Kestrel Bay deployments.
- Chart units default to metric. The imperial fallback flag is deprecated and will be removed in 3.4.
- Cache eviction is now time-based, not size-based.

New installs should start from the default configuration values listed below.

config for kahap-taweg:
oliox:
  pin: 8609
  tenant: casath
  seal: seal_632a4a6f
  metrics_host: metrics.oliox.nelvrogrid.example
  standby_team: keleth
  escalation: briiel-oliwyn
  nonce: e2397c

## Local Setup

Welcome to GridWit, our crossword generator! Clone the repo, run `make deps`, and start the puzzle service with `make serve`. Clue data lives in a shared Postgres instance, so you don't need to seed anything locally. Just point your dev environment at the shared database using the connection string below.

primary connection of yagep-kahip = redis://giliel_svc:zYiKsLL2PLpfPL@db-348f.xolmarsys.corp:5432/fenwyn

## Search Relevance — New Hire Notes (Korvid Search)

Boosts live in `relevance.yaml`. Never edit in prod. Run the offline eval first; anything below 0.61 NDCG gets rejected by CI. Synonym lists sync nightly from the Lexden service. Questions go to the relevance channel. To run evals locally, the harness needs access to the judgment store, configured by this env line:

env line for fafof-fahag: LEDGER_TOKEN5=f8790